After 12 long years in production, Saturn is finally retiring its aging S-Series sedan and coupe in favor of the all-new Saturn Ion sedan and innovative quad coupe.
- Innovative rear-access doors on coupe, customer-focused dealers, numerous personalization options, great cargo capacity.
- Build quality not up to segment standards, unusual styling, lack of established service and repair history.

Fooled by Good Looks - 2003 Saturn ION
By Fooled by Good Looks - November 2 - 7:23 pmMy husband and I fell in love with both the exterior and interior style of the all-new ION, especially the center-console gauge cluster. I told my husband that the seating was uncomfortable, but he said it would be better in leather. After a 1,000-mile round trip, we were both seeing a chiropractor (the rear seats are even worse). Ive asked the Service Dept. to fix the transmission problem twice (rough shifting between first, second and third gears), but the problem remains. The steEring wheel binds in cold weather, another problem Ive asked to have fixed two times to no avail. I cant wait to pass this car on to someone who can take seats made out of concrete!

Quiet,quick and responsive. - 2003 Saturn ION
By jimbob67 - August 11 - 2:00 amWe bought our Saturn Ion 3 in January. As far as reliabiliy 2 months is not enought time to fully judge, but so far no problems.. with anything. I like the smaller than usual steering weel which frees up room and contributes to the very responsive steering. The leather seats are nicley sewn dispite what I have read about the fabric seats. The 2.2l echotech 140 hp engine has plenty of power and does very well on the interstate.The automatic lighting is a plus and the 160 watt advanced audio kicks. The car could use wider leg room though.

1st Saturn purchase - 2003 Saturn ION
By MCGIRL - August 6 - 10:00 amI absolutely love my car. It is fun to drive. It gets noticed. Everyone has a comment about its unique styling, i.e. center mounted cluster bezel. My mom bought one within weeks of my purchase. However, be mindful of purchasing this car if you have children-especially big ones. I have 3. I can only transport two in the rear seat in car seats. With car seats in place, I cannot fit a 3rd person, even a small one in the rear seat. Although Ive got my sites on buying an SUV in the near future since Im doing most of the family transporting, I hope to hang on to this car as my "fun car".

Good Little Car - 2003 Saturn ION
By Kimberly1 - March 7 - 2:00 amI have been pleased with the performance of the Ion. It has a lot of nice features (big trunk, rear folding seats, speedometer is in the middle, etc). My biggest complaint about the vehicle is that the transmission slips (almost always) when you quicly accelerate while turning-- usually from a standstill while turning left--I do not know why this happens and I would like to know if there are any other Ion owners who have their transmission slip on them now and then.
